Find myself both agreeing and disagreeing with this. All comes
down to character of the individual involved so I feel it's by
degrees.
You could say that NEv came through in just the same way. The
question is whether they can command a different kind of respect
from the senior players in the squad when they retire compared
to the respect they had as part of that cohort as a player. What
we may never know is how much Nick Easter's short stint as
defence coach was primarily down to his failure to shift that
relationship between himself and the likes of Joe, Mike, Danny,
Chris - or other factors. Probably a mixture of both, ratio
unknown.
The business analogy actually contradicts your argument - people
get promoted into management from the main working pool in
companies across the country every day. The success of that
promotion often comes down (in part at least) to how that
individual is able to transition their relationships with those
who used to be their peers - and how much support they get from
the suits above in order to make that transition successful. Of
course, there are always multiple factors at play.
